    Minecraft is a child-friendly computer game that combines exploration and survival skills. It tests children’s imagination and creativity.   5. Apr 22, 2022 · Minecraft Mining. Mining is also a big part of Minecraft, it’s a way to gather materials to use in survival mode. You can search to discover a mine that already exists or just start digging to create your own mine. Mining allows you to gather different types of stone, metal, and gems for building and crafting.
